Find the velocities of iron blocks weighing 50 kg and 100 kg if they are dropped from a height of 100 m at the same time.

Answers

Answer:

44.294 m/s

you might want to double check the answer depending on what you use for g. some people use 9.81, some 9.8, and some 10. that can effect the final answer

Explanation:

use the formula [tex]v^{2}-v_{0}^{2} = 2ax[/tex], which can be moved around to get [tex]v = \sqrt{2ax}[/tex]

note that mass does not effect the velocity

since the blocks were dropped from rest, v_0 = 0m/s. a = g = 9.81 m/s^2, and x = h = 100m.

plug in the values for the variables to get v = sqrt(2(9.81)(100)) = 44.294 m/s for both blocks

1. A charge of 6.4 C passes through a cross-sectional area or conductor in 2s. How much charge will pass through a cross sectional area of the conductor in 1 min?​

Answers

The amount of charge that will pass through the cross-sectional area of the conductor in 1 min is 192 C.

What is the  amount of charge?

We can use the formula Q = I * t,

where;

Q is the amount of charge, I is the current, and t is the time.

Given that a charge of 6.4 C passes through a cross-sectional area of the conductor in 2 s, we can find the current using the formula:

I = Q / t = 6.4 C / 2 s = 3.2 A

So, the current through the conductor is 3.2 A.

To find the amount of charge that will pass through the cross-sectional area of the conductor in 1 min (60 s), we can use the same formula:

Q = I * t = 3.2 A * 60 s = 192 C

Derive Lorentz transformation​

Answers

Lorentz transformation is a mathematical framework that describes how the coordinates of an event in space and time change for two observers in relative motion.

What is Lorentz transformation?

Consider two inertial frames of reference, S and S', moving relative to each other along the x-axis with a constant velocity v. Let an event occur at position (x, y, z, t) in frame S, and let (x', y', z', t') be the corresponding position in frame S'.

The transformation equations for space and time are given by:

[tex]x' = γ(x - vt)\\y' = y\\z' = z\\t' = γ(t - vx/c^2)[/tex]

where[tex]γ = 1/√(1 - v^2/c^2)[/tex] is the Lorentz factor, and c is the speed of light.

These equations show how the coordinates of an event in one frame of reference are related to the coordinates in another frame of reference that is moving relative to the first frame. They are known as the Lorentz transformations and are a fundamental aspect of special relativity.

The speed limit on a highway in lower slovakia was given as 120,000 furlongs per fortnight. How many miles per hour is this? one furlong is 1/8 mile and a fortnight is 14 days. A furlong originally referred to the length of a plowed furrow.

Answers

The required speed limit on a highway in lower slovakia is 20,000 furlongs per fortnight. And its value in miles per hour is 44.64 miles per hour.

The speed limit is given as 120000 furlongs per fortnight.

1 furlong is given as 1/8 miles.

120000 furlongs is equal to 120000/8 = 15000 miles per fortnight

Let us convert miles per fortnight to miles per hour.

1 fortnight is known to be 14 days

1 day = 24 hours

14 day = 24 × 14 = 336 hours

15000 miles per fortnight = 15000/336 = 44.64 miles per hour

Thus, 120,000 furlongs per fortnight is nothing but 44.64 miles per hour.

an object is horizontally dragged across the surface by a 100N force acting parallel to the surface.find the amount of work done by the force in movING the object through a distance of 8m​

Answers

Answer:

the amount of work done by the force in moving the object through a distance of 8m is 800 Joules.

Explanation:

The work done by a force is given by the product of the force and the distance moved in the direction of the force. In this case, the force is acting parallel to the surface and causing the object to move horizontally, so the work done is:

Work = force x distance

Work = 100N x 8m

Work = 800 Joules (J)

Therefore, the amount of work done by the force in moving the object through a distance of 8m is 800 Joules.
